Social workers in schools (SWis)

WHat is the swis programme about

Social Workers in Schools (SWIS) are the social workers who work within the 12 schools Te Aka Ora Support in partnership with MSD and MOE.
​SWIS are an integral link between school, home, and community in helping students achieve academic success. They work directly with whanau, students and school administration, providing support and behaviour development programmes for young people and their whanau, to ensure the young person is well supported in both the home and school environments.

​SWIS workers also provide guidance and support to leadership in forming school discipline policies, mental health intervention, crisis management, and support services. As part of an interdisciplinary team to help students succeed, school social workers also facilitate community involvement in the schools while advocating for student success.
Our community and social workers have many years of experience providing individualised plans to support children and families who have diverse needs.  We work in schools across Gisborne urban area and western rural schools.

partnering Schools 

Te Aka Ora partner with 12 schools around the Gisborne Districts and Gisborne City area. The schools are as follows:
GISBORNE DISTRICTS:
Te Kura Kaupapa Maori o Whatatutu
Te Karaka Area School
Patutahi School
Te Kura o Manutuke
Muriwai School

GISBORNE CITY:
Horouta Wananga
​Te Kura Maori o Nga Uri a Maui
Riverdale School
Te Hapara School
Awapuni School
Cobham School
Elgin School
